True Grit

Thanks to a hungry cat, I was up at 4:30 am yesterday morning, clicking through the cable channels, and chanced upon "True Grit." Now, until about seven (or so) months ago, I would have just kept right on clicking, but since my "conversion" to being able to appreciate Western-themed media, I watched it (well, most of it -- I missed about 30 minutes in the middle). And am I glad that I watched it! Until this, I only knew Kim Darby from her portrayal of Miri in a Star Trek episode - and as Lane's mother in "Better Off Dead." Her performance here was remarkable, and her contrast & relationship with Cogburn was simply amazing. And would you believe that I'd never even seen a John Wayne movie -- I only knew his reputation. And I was quite surprised to see a young Glenn Campbell - I had no idea that he had ever appeared in a motion picture.

I enjoyed the movie very much. Crusty, humorous, stunning scenery & locations, and worthy of at least 3 stars...maybe a bit more.
